Family law attorneys in Amherst Massachusetts help clients navigate divorce child custody child support and spousal maintenance. Massachusetts law uses a no-fault divorce system under M.G.L. c. 208. The Hampshire County Probate and Family Court serves Amherst residents. Local attorneys understand the specific procedures of this court.

What Does a Family Law Attorney in Amherst Cost?

Family law attorney fees in Massachusetts typically range from 250 to 500 dollars per hour. A simple uncontested divorce may cost between 2,500 and 5,000 dollars in total fees. A complex contested divorce with custody or property issues can cost 10,000 to 30,000 dollars or more. Many attorneys require a retainer of 3,000 to 10,000 dollars upfront. This is general information and not legal adv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the residency requirement for divorce in Amherst Massachusetts?
At least one spouse must have lived in Massachusetts for one year before filing for divorce. For a no-fault divorce under M.G.L. c. 208 section 1A you must state that the marriage is irretrievably broken. The case is heard in Hampshire County Probate and Family Court.
How is child custody decided in Massachusetts family court?
Massachusetts courts decide custody based on the best interests of the child under M.G.L. c. 208 section 31. Factors include the childs relationship with each parent the parents ability to provide care and any history of abuse. The court may order joint legal custody or sole legal custody.
